This FRQ from the 2025 AP Calculus AB and BC set presents us with a graph consisting of a line segment and two semicircles. Over the course of the problem, we use the Fundamental Theorem of Calculus to determine the derivative of a function defined as a definite integral, utilize the graph of a derivative to determine the location of inflection points, use signed area arguments to determine several values of a function defined as a definite integral, and determine the absolute minimum of the function defined as a definite integral using the Extreme Value Theorem.
